STATUTORY RULES.

1942. No. 86.

 

REGULATIONS UNDER THE NATIONAL SECURITY ACT 1939-1940.*

I, THE GOVERNOR-GENERAL in and over the Commonwealth of Australia, acting with the advice of the Federal Executive Council, hereby make the following Regulations under the National Security Act 1939-1940.

Dated this twenty-fifth day of February, 1942.

GOWRIE

Governor-General.

By His Excellency’s Command,

F. M. FORDE

for and on behalf of the Minister of State for Defence Co-ordination.

 

Amendments of National Security (Aliens Service) Regulations. 

Definitions.

1. Regulation 2 of the National Security (Aliens Service) Regulations is amended by omitting from the definition of “refugee alien” the words “alien enemy” and inserting in their stead the words “enemy alien”.

Service by refugee aliens and enemy aliens other than refugee aliens.

2. Regulation 8 of the National Security (Aliens Service) Regulations is amended—

(a) by omitting sub-regulation (1.) and inserting in its stead the following sub-regulation:—

“(1.) The Minister of State for the Army may direct that—

(a) Any male refugee alien under the age of sixty years who has not, within fourteen days after he first became liable to register, volunteered and been accepted for service in any part of the Naval Military or Air Forces of the Commonwealth; and

(b) Any male enemy alien other than a refugee alien;

shall perform such service in Australia as is directed by the Minister of State for Labour and National Service,

not being service as a member of any armed forces, but being service which the alien is, in the opinion of the Minister of State for Labour and National Service, capable of performing.”;

(b) by inserting in sub-regulation (2.) after the words “refugee aliens”, the words “or enemy aliens other than refugee aliens”;

(c) by omitting from sub-regulations (3.) and (4.) the word “refugee” (wherever occurring); and

(d) by inserting in sub-regulation (6.) after the words “refugee alien”, the words “or an enemy alien other than a refugee alien.”
